28
29 typedef struct
30 {
31 PyObject_HEAD
32
33 /* The corresponding objfile. */
34 struct objfile *objfile;
35
36 /* Dictionary holding user-added attributes.
37 This is the __dict__ attribute of the object. */
38 PyObject *dict;
39
40 /* The pretty-printer list of functions. */
41 PyObject *printers;
42
43 /* The frame filter list of functions. */
44 PyObject *frame_filters;
45
46 /* The list of frame unwinders. */
47 PyObject *frame_unwinders;
48
49 /* The type-printer list. */
50 PyObject *type_printers;
51
52 /* The debug method matcher list. */
53 PyObject *xmethods;
54 } objfile_object;
55
56 extern PyTypeObject objfile_object_type
57 CPYCHECKER_TYPE_OBJECT_FOR_TYPEDEF ("objfile_object");
58
59 static const struct objfile_data *objfpy_objfile_data_key;
60
61 /* Require that OBJF be a valid objfile. */
62 #define OBJFPY_REQUIRE_VALID(obj) \
63 do { \
64 if (!(obj)->objfile) \
65 { \
66 PyErr_SetString (PyExc_RuntimeError, \
67 _("Objfile no longer exists.")); \
68 return NULL; \
69 } \
70 } while (0)
71
72 \f
73
74 /* An Objfile method which returns the objfile's file name, or None. */
75
76 static PyObject *
77 objfpy_get_filename (PyObject *self, void *closure)
78 {
79 objfile_object *obj = (objfile_object *) self;
80
81 if (obj->objfile)
82 return host_string_to_python_string (objfile_name (obj->objfile));
83 Py_RETURN_NONE;
84 }
85
86 /* An Objfile method which returns the objfile's file name, as specified
87 by the user, or None. */
88
89 static PyObject *
90 objfpy_get_username (PyObject *self, void *closure)
91 {
92 objfile_object *obj = (objfile_object *) self;
93
94 if (obj->objfile)
95 {
96 const char *username = obj->objfile->original_name;
97
98 return host_string_to_python_string (username);
99 }
100
101 Py_RETURN_NONE;
102 }
103
104 /* If SELF is a separate debug-info file, return the "backlink" field.
105 Otherwise return None. */
106
107 static PyObject *
108 objfpy_get_owner (PyObject *self, void *closure)
109 {
110 objfile_object *obj = (objfile_object *) self;
111 struct objfile *objfile = obj->objfile;
112 struct objfile *owner;
113
114 OBJFPY_REQUIRE_VALID (obj);
115
116 owner = objfile->separate_debug_objfile_backlink;
117 if (owner != NULL)
118 return objfile_to_objfile_object (owner).release ();
119 Py_RETURN_NONE;
120 }
121
122 /* An Objfile method which returns the objfile's build id, or None. */
123
124 static PyObject *
125 objfpy_get_build_id (PyObject *self, void *closure)
126 {
127 objfile_object *obj = (objfile_object *) self;
128 struct objfile *objfile = obj->objfile;
129 const struct bfd_build_id *build_id = NULL;
130
131 OBJFPY_REQUIRE_VALID (obj);
132
133 TRY
134 {
135 build_id = build_id_bfd_get (objfile->obfd);
136 }
137 CATCH (except, RETURN_MASK_ALL)
138 {
139 GDB_PY_HANDLE_EXCEPTION (except);
140 }
141 END_CATCH
142
143 if (build_id != NULL)
144 {
145 char *hex_form = make_hex_string (build_id->data, build_id->size);
146 PyObject *result;
147
148 result = host_string_to_python_string (hex_form);
149 xfree (hex_form);
150 return result;
151 }
152
153 Py_RETURN_NONE;
154 }
155
156 /* An Objfile method which returns the objfile's progspace, or None. */
157
158 static PyObject *
159 objfpy_get_progspace (PyObject *self, void *closure)
160 {
161 objfile_object *obj = (objfile_object *) self;
162
163 if (obj->objfile)
164 return pspace_to_pspace_object (obj->objfile->pspace).release ();
165
166 Py_RETURN_NONE;
167 }
168
169 static void
170 objfpy_dealloc (PyObject *o)
171 {
172 objfile_object *self = (objfile_object *) o;
173
174 Py_XDECREF (self->dict);
175 Py_XDECREF (self->printers);
176 Py_XDECREF (self->frame_filters);
177 Py_XDECREF (self->frame_unwinders);
178 Py_XDECREF (self->type_printers);
179 Py_XDECREF (self->xmethods);
180 Py_TYPE (self)->tp_free (self);
181 }

462 }
463
464 /* Subroutine of gdbpy_lookup_objfile_by_build_id to simplify it.
465 Return non-zero if STRING is a potentially valid build id. */
466
467 static int
468 objfpy_build_id_ok (const char *string)
469 {
470 size_t i, n = strlen (string);
471
472 if (n % 2 != 0)
473 return 0;
474 for (i = 0; i < n; ++i)
475 {
476 if (!isxdigit (string[i]))
477 return 0;
478 }
479 return 1;
480 }
481
482 /* Subroutine of gdbpy_lookup_objfile_by_build_id to simplify it.
483 Returns non-zero if BUILD_ID matches STRING.
484 It is assumed that objfpy_build_id_ok (string) returns TRUE. */
485
486 static int
487 objfpy_build_id_matches (const struct bfd_build_id *build_id,
488 const char *string)
489 {
490 size_t i;
491
492 if (strlen (string) != 2 * build_id->size)
493 return 0;
494
495 for (i = 0; i < build_id->size; ++i)
496 {
497 char c1 = string[i * 2], c2 = string[i * 2 + 1];
498 int byte = (host_hex_value (c1) << 4) | host_hex_value (c2);
499
500 if (byte != build_id->data[i])
501 return 0;
502 }
503
504 return 1;
505 }
506
507 /* Subroutine of gdbpy_lookup_objfile to simplify it.
508 Look up an objfile by its file name. */
509
510 static struct objfile *
511 objfpy_lookup_objfile_by_name (const char *name)
512 {
513 struct objfile *objfile;
514
515 ALL_OBJFILES (objfile)
516 {
517 const char *filename;
518
519 if ((objfile->flags & OBJF_NOT_FILENAME) != 0)
520 continue;
521 /* Don't return separate debug files. */
522 if (objfile->separate_debug_objfile_backlink != NULL)
523 continue;
524
525 filename = objfile_filename (objfile);
526 if (filename != NULL && compare_filenames_for_search (filename, name))
527 return objfile;
528 if (compare_filenames_for_search (objfile->original_name, name))
529 return objfile;
530 }
531
532 return NULL;
533 }
534
535 /* Subroutine of gdbpy_lookup_objfile to simplify it.
536 Look up an objfile by its build id. */
537
538 static struct objfile *
539 objfpy_lookup_objfile_by_build_id (const char *build_id)
540 {
541 struct objfile *objfile;
542
543 ALL_OBJFILES (objfile)
544 {
545 const struct bfd_build_id *obfd_build_id;
546
547 if (objfile->obfd == NULL)
548 continue;
549 /* Don't return separate debug files. */
550 if (objfile->separate_debug_objfile_backlink != NULL)
551 continue;
552 obfd_build_id = build_id_bfd_get (objfile->obfd);
553 if (obfd_build_id == NULL)
554 continue;
555 if (objfpy_build_id_matches (obfd_build_id, build_id))
556 return objfile;
557 }
558
559 return NULL;
560 }
561
562 /* Implementation of gdb.lookup_objfile. */
563
564 PyObject *
565 gdbpy_lookup_objfile (PyObject *self, PyObject *args, PyObject *kw)
566 {
567 static const char *keywords[] = { "name", "by_build_id", NULL };
568 const char *name;
569 PyObject *by_build_id_obj = NULL;
570 int by_build_id;
571 struct objfile *objfile;
572
573 if (!gdb_PyArg_ParseTupleAndKeywords (args, kw, "s|O!", keywords,
574 &name, &PyBool_Type, &by_build_id_obj))
575 return NULL;
576
577 by_build_id = 0;
578 if (by_build_id_obj != NULL)
579 {
580 int cmp = PyObject_IsTrue (by_build_id_obj);
581
582 if (cmp < 0)
583 return NULL;
584 by_build_id = cmp;
585 }
586
587 if (by_build_id)
588 {
589 if (!objfpy_build_id_ok (name))
590 {
591 PyErr_SetString (PyExc_TypeError, _("Not a valid build id."));
592 return NULL;
593 }
594 objfile = objfpy_lookup_objfile_by_build_id (name);
595 }
596 else
597 objfile = objfpy_lookup_objfile_by_name (name);
598
599 if (objfile != NULL)
600 return objfile_to_objfile_object (objfile).release ();
601
602 PyErr_SetString (PyExc_ValueError, _("Objfile not found."));
603 return NULL;

606 \f
607
608 /* Clear the OBJFILE pointer in an Objfile object and remove the
609 reference. */
610 static void
611 py_free_objfile (struct objfile *objfile, void *datum)
612 {
613 gdbpy_enter enter_py (get_objfile_arch (objfile), current_language);
614 gdbpy_ref<objfile_object> object ((objfile_object *) datum);
615 object->objfile = NULL;
616 }
617
618 /* Return a new reference to the Python object of type Objfile
619 representing OBJFILE. If the object has already been created,
620 return it. Otherwise, create it. Return NULL and set the Python
621 error on failure. */
622
623 gdbpy_ref<>
624 objfile_to_objfile_object (struct objfile *objfile)
625 {
626 PyObject *result
627 = ((PyObject *) objfile_data (objfile, objfpy_objfile_data_key));
628 if (result == NULL)
629 {
630 gdbpy_ref<objfile_object> object
631 ((objfile_object *) PyObject_New (objfile_object, &objfile_object_type));
632 if (object == NULL)
633 return NULL;
634 if (!objfpy_initialize (object.get ()))
635 return NULL;
636
637 object->objfile = objfile;
638 set_objfile_data (objfile, objfpy_objfile_data_key, object.get ());
639 result = (PyObject *) object.release ();
640 }
641
642 return gdbpy_ref<>::new_reference (result);
643 }
644
645 int
646 gdbpy_initialize_objfile (void)
647 {
648 objfpy_objfile_data_key
649 = register_objfile_data_with_cleanup (NULL, py_free_objfile);
650
651 if (PyType_Ready (&objfile_object_type) < 0)
652 return -1;
653
654 return gdb_pymodule_addobject (gdb_module, "Objfile",
655 (PyObject *) &objfile_object_type);
